Slater-Marietta Gym Roof Replacement Project
Solicitation # 127-3
The School District of Greenville County is soliciting sealed bids from qualified general contractors for the replacement of the roof at Slater-Marietta Elementary School, located at 100 Baker Circle, Marietta, South Carolina. The project involves the removal and installation of new roofing systems over designated areas labeled A1, B1, and B2, as detailed in Drawings G-001 through S-101 and associated specifications. All work must comply with industry standards including ASTM D6878, UL 790, ASTM E108, OSHA regulations, SCBC, NFPA, and SCAQMD guidelines, ensuring durability, fire resistance, and environmental compliance. The contract includes allowances for wood blocking and wood plank deck replacement, with a $50,000 owner’s contingency fund, though unit prices for these items are left blank for bidder completion, making the total contract value dependent on proposed rates and actual scope execution. Bids must be submitted electronically through the District’s Procurement Portal by 10:00 AM on August 18, 2026, with no faxed or emailed submissions accepted. The award will not be based solely on the lowest price but rather on the most advantageous rate in the District’s best interest, evaluating responsiveness, price reasonableness, past experience, and technical compliance. All contractors must be registered in SAM, undergo a debarment check, and ensure that all personnel access to the site pass criminal background checks and sex offender registry screenings. Materials must be stored properly off the ground, protected from moisture, and handled according to manufacturer guidelines, with wet or damaged items replaced immediately. The District retains full ownership of all data, deliverables, and documentation generated under the contract and prohibits any use of its name, logo, or endorsement in the contractor’s marketing. Payment will be processed via AIA Form G702 and G703, certified by the Designer, using ACH or P-Card, with no partial payments allowed. The contract permits termination for non-appropriation at the end of the fiscal year, termination for convenience with 30–60 days’ notice, or immediate termination for cause involving safety violations or material default. Price increases are capped at 3% annually or tied to the CPI-U, requiring 60 days’ written request and District approval.
